Territory exclusivity for the Brindlemoor corridor remains the open point; our counsel recommends a five-year carve-out with renewal triggers tied to volume. Royalty terms, training obligations, and fit-out standards are settled. Malbren will chair the closing session and circulate the signature version. Please hold all external commentary until then. The confidential planning note follows below.

management briefing: Project Ulavan slips by two quarters because of the staffing delay.

Scanner: Lintrap typo-squat detector. If scans stall, check the Levenshtein index rebuild job first — it locks the candidate table for up to 10 minutes nightly. False positives on hyphenated names: known issue, see the allowlist in config/squatlist.yml. If the registry mirror at Fennmark rejects requests with 401, the service account rotated. Re-auth manually before restarting workers, otherwise the queue backs up silently. Staging credentials for manual re-auth are appended below this line.

session JWT of yawep-yawep = eyJhbGciOiJIUzI1NiIsInR5cCI6IkpXVCJ9.eyJzdWIiOiI3pWF3_In0.aXYsHiog

Q: How does Cartelline invalidate catalog cache entries after a price change?
A: Writes to the Prydo catalog emit invalidation events; edge nodes purge within 30 seconds. No stale-read window beyond that. Manual flushes require the ops vault, unlocked by the recovery passphrase below.

vault phrase of taweg-kafof = oliax-zorael

Health checks for Perchstack services sit behind the Kestrel load balancer. Each node answers on a dedicated status endpoint; three consecutive failures pull it from rotation. Do not restart nodes manually during drain — the balancer handles reattachment. If a node flaps repeatedly, escalate to the platform on-call. Check intervals, timeout values, and the current node roster for every environment are maintained on the internal page linked below.

operations page: https://vault.qorvelcorp.example/settings